ARTICLE-9
[
go to this ARTICLE
]
... (2) It shall be a matter for
legislation
in the
countries
of the
Union
to
permit
the
reproduction
of such
works
in certain
special
cases
, provided that such
reproduction
does not
conflict
with a
normal
exploitation
of the
work
and does not unreasonably
prejudice
the
legitimate interests
of the
author
. ...
ARTICLE-14ter
[
go to this ARTICLE
]
... (1) The
author
, or after his
death
the
persons
or
institutions
authorized
by
national legislation
, shall, with
respect
to
original works
of
art
and
original
manuscripts
of
writers
and
composers
, enjoy the
inalienable right
to an
interest
in any
sale
of the
work
subsequent
to the first
transfer
by the
author
of the
work
. ...
